What Is a Plumbing Emergency in Knox?

So, what is an emergency plumber, and what do they do? An emergency plumber is a licensed professional available 24 hours a day, 7 days a week, including holidays, to handle urgent plumbing problems that can't wait. They are the first responders for your home's water and sewer systems. But what is classed as a plumbing emergency? It's any situation that poses an immediate threat to your property, health, or safety. In our local climate, where winter freezes are harsh and summer storms can be intense, certain issues are especially critical.

Here in Knox, with our mix of historic homes near the courthouse square and newer builds in areas like the Wellington Heights addition, plumbing emergencies often look like this:

  • Burst or Frozen Pipes: During heavy winter freezes in Knox, pipes in unheated crawl spaces, basements, or exterior walls can freeze and burst. This is a top emergency.
  • Sewer Line Backups: After heavy spring rains saturate the ground around Knox, older clay sewer lines in neighborhoods like Bass Lake can fail, sending sewage back into your home.
  • Major Water Leaks: A broken water heater, a failed pressure valve, or a cracked supply line can flood a room quickly.
  • Complete Loss of Water: If your well pump fails or a main line breaks, having no water is a health and safety issue.
  • Gas Line Leaks (if your plumber is gas-certified): If you smell gas, evacuate and call 911 first, then a qualified emergency plumber.
  • Severe Clogged Toilets or Drains: If it's the only toilet in the house and it's overflowing, that's an urgent need.

What is considered emergency plumbing? If water is actively causing damage, if there's a risk of flooding, or if a basic health need (like a working toilet) is gone, it's an emergency. For less urgent issues—a slow drain, a dripping faucet, a running toilet—it's usually safe to schedule a regular appointment.

When Should I Call an Emergency Plumber in Knox?

Knowing when to call can save you stress and money. As a rule, if you're asking "Is this bad enough?" it probably is. In our community, where many homes have basements that can flood or older galvanized steel pipes that are prone to sudden failure, erring on the side of caution is smart. Call an emergency plumber in Knox, IN immediately if:

  • You see or hear gushing water.
  • You have standing water that's rising.
  • You smell sewer gas inside the home.
  • You have no water at all on a well system.
  • Pipes are frozen and you cannot safely thaw them.
  • There is any suspicion of a gas leak (after calling 911).

For issues like a water heater making noise or a minor leak you can contain with a bucket, you can likely call during normal business hours. The geography of our area, with its clay soil that shifts with freeze-thaw cycles, puts extra stress on underground pipes, so don't ignore persistent slow drains—they can signal a bigger problem brewing.

What to Do Until Your Knox Emergency Plumber Arrives

When you have an emergency, every minute counts. Here’s how to prepare and minimize damage until we get there:

  1. Shut Off the Water: Know where your main water shut-off valve is (often in the basement, crawl space, or near the water meter) and turn it clockwise to stop all water flow.
  2. Turn Off the Water Heater: If the leak is major, switch your electric water heater to "off" at the breaker or turn the gas valve to "pilot" to prevent damage.
  3. Contain Small Leaks: Use buckets, towels, or duct tape for temporary patches.
  4. Open Drains & Spigots: If pipes are frozen, open faucets to relieve pressure once thawing begins.
  5. Move Valuables: Get rugs, electronics, and furniture out of the water's path.
  6. Document the Damage: Take photos for your insurance company.

Local Challenges: Knox's Climate and Home Types

Our local conditions directly impact your plumbing. Knox experiences cold, snowy winters where pipes in poorly insulated additions or vacation homes can freeze. Our summers bring humidity and occasional heavy rains that test sump pumps and saturate the ground, leading to sewer line stress. Homes built before 1950 in Knox often have original plumbing that is nearing the end of its lifespan.

If you live in an older neighborhood, be vigilant for signs of pipe corrosion or tree root intrusion in sewer lines. If you have a basement, ensure your sump pump is working before the spring thaw.
